An industrial unit in Yasuj, Iran, is fully dedicated to the production of licorice powder and extract, which are then exported primarily to European countries, including Germany, and to a limited extent, South Africa. The price per kilogram for licorice powder and extract are $3.8 and $3.3 respectively, and the factory has created employment for 55 people. Licorice, known for its bitterness and numerous health benefits, is used in various industries such as pharmaceutical, cosmetic, confectionery, beverage, and is effective in treating a range of ailments including respiratory and digestive problems.
